Richard J.
Ryan served as the Managing Director of SEACOR Marine (International) Ltd.
from 1996 to 2005.
He was also the Chief Financial Officer & Senior Vice President of SEACOR Holdings, Inc. from 1996 to 2014 and held the same position at Seabulk International, Inc. Additionally, he served as a Director at Era Group, Inc. Mr. Ryan holds an MBA from the University of East Anglia.

SEACOR Holdings, Inc.
SEACOR Holdings, Inc. Marine ShippingTransportation SEACOR Holdings, Inc. engages in the provision of transportation and logistics solutions through its subsidiaries. It operates through the following segments: Ocean Transportation and Logistics Services; Inland Transportation and Logistics Services; Witt O'Brien's; and Other. The Ocean Transportation and Logistics Services segment owns and operates a fleet of bulk transportation, port and infrastructure, and logistics assets, including U.S. coastwise eligible vessels and vessels trading internationally. The Inland Transportation and Logistics Services segment provides customer supply chain solutions with its domestic river transportation equipment, fleeting services and high-speed multi-modal terminal locations adjacent to and along the U.S. Inland Waterways. The Witt O'Brien's segment offers crisis and emergency management services for both the public and private sectors. The Other segment consists other activities and non-controlling investments in various other businesses. The company was founded by Charles L. Fabrikant in 1989 and is headquartered in Fort Lauderdale, FL. | Transportation |

Era Group, Inc.
Era Group, Inc. Other TransportationTransportation Era Group, Inc. engages in the provision of helicopter transportation services. It offers oil and gas transport, search and rescue, emergency medical services, leasing, fleet support, and Era unmanned aerial solutions. The company was founded on April 29, 1999 and is headquartered in Houston, TX. | Transportation |
